• The stabilizer function may not be
effective in the following cases.
– When there is a lot of jitter.
– When the zoom magnification is high.
– In digital zoom range.
– When taking pictures while following a
moving subject.
– When the shutter speed becomes
slower to take pictures indoors or in dark
places.
Be careful of camera jitter when you press
the shutter button.

When burst is set to [ON], it is activated
while the shutter button is pressed.
• You can only take one picture when the
flash is activated.
• The burst speed becomes slower
halfway. The exact timing of this depends
on the type of card, the picture size and
the quality.
• You can take pictures until the capacity of
the built-in memory or the card is full.
• The burst speed becomes slower if the
ISO sensitivity (P42, 59) is set to [ISO400]
or higher.
• The burst speed may become slower in
dark places because the shutter speed
becomes slower.
